Entradas

Mostrando las entradas de septiembre, 2017

Mosquito con WS sobre apache2

Instalar Mosquitto con Websockets Primero debemos instalar mosquitto con compatibilidad para websockets, en esta entrada esta enfocada para Ubuntu, para puedes consultar esta entrada para opensuse . Instalando dependencias. $ sudo apt-get update $ sudo apt-get install build-essential python quilt devscripts python-setuptools libssl-dev cmake libc-ares-dev uuid-dev Instalando libwebsockets $ wget https://github.com/warmcat/libwebsockets/archive/v1.3-chrome37-firefox30.tar.gz $ tar zxvf v1.3-chrome37-firefox30.tar.gz $ cd libwebsockets/ $ mkdir build $ cd build/ $ sudo cmake .. -DOPENSSL_ROOT_DIR=/usr/bin/openssl $ sudo make $ sudo make install Descarga el código de mosquitto. $ wget http://mosquitto.org/files/source/mosquitto-1.4.2.tar.gz $ tar zxvf mosquitto-1.4.2.tar.gz $ cd mosquitto-1.4.2 Edita el archivo config.mk cambiando la siguiente linea: WITH_WEBSOCKETS:=no A WITH_WEBSOCKETS:=yes $ sudo make $ sudo mak